Claims Negotiator
We are looking for a detail-oriented individual to support claims negotiation activities within the health insurance space for a contract position. This role focuses on coordinating with healthcare providers to establish reimbursement arrangements for out-of-network services while ensuring each case progresses accurately and efficiently. The ideal candidate brings strong written and verbal communication, sound judgment, and the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ced remote environment.
Responsibilities:
• Evaluate incoming case assignments, interpret referral details, and determine the appropriate next steps for negotiation activity.
• Contact healthcare providers to discuss case specifics, gather needed information, and build productive working relationships throughout the process.
• Lead conversations to secure acceptable reimbursement terms and complete single-case or comparable payment agreements when needed.
• Prepare, revise, and track Letters of Agreement to ensure terms are clearly documented and processed in a timely manner.
• Keep providers and internal stakeholders informed on case progress from initial outreach through final resolution.
• Conduct quality checks on case documentation and agreement details to confirm accuracy, completeness, and adherence to standards.
• Coordinate required authorizations, approvals, and signatures so agreements can be finalized without unnecessary delay.
• Record case activity thoroughly and maintain organized files that reflect current status, negotiated terms, and supporting documentation.
• Follow established workflows, compliance expectations, and procedural guidelines while advancing cases toward closure.
• Distribute completed agreements, confirm final processing steps, and close cases once all documentation requirements have been satisfied.
